You can see accelerometer trims on the first page of configurator, above the save button.

Image

If LEDs aren't a good option for you, there is a place to install a DC buzzer on the naze and you can hear confirmation beeps during calibration and trimming.

WOw! those pic came out obnoxiously big. Here are the links to them: * & m Imgur will auto resize your images for you as you link to them. If you append 'l' just before the .jpg extension you'll link to a large (640) pixel image for posting on forums and such. Use 'h' for a huge (1024). Or 'm' ...
